backdrop
poster

Star Leaf

Star Leaf

Release: 2015-06-06 ·Runtime: 77m ·★ 3.8
Phim Kinh Dị Phim Khoa Học Viễn Tưởng Phim Gây Cấn

No overview available.

Production Countries

United States of America

Production Companies

Titan Sky Entertainment

Trailers & Videos